Webb19 juli 2024 · If there’s a milk-like fluid in the seafood case, the scallops are most likely wet. Also keep an eye out if the scallops are fresh or frozen. While frozen may be less … Webb28 juli 2024 · Their taste is light and briny, not heavy or metallic. If your scallops taste or smell like ammonia, do not eat them. The smell of ammonia in scallops shows that they …
Webb21 sep. 2024 · Instructions. Remove the tough side muscle flap from each scallop, rinse under cold water, and dry well. Sprinkle with a little salt and pepper and set aside. In a large skillet, over medium-high heat, add the butter and olive oil to pan. Once the butter melts, add the scallops in a single layer and cook 2 minutes on each side.
